It's clear that peptides are an important and highly beneficial skin care ingredient — but when it comes to choosing the best peptide serums, knowing how to use them properly, and what products to pair them with, things get a little murkier. That's why I turned to Dr. Ava Shamban, a board-certified dermatologist, for more information on the topic.

First, some background. "Peptides are building blocks in our body that naturally support key cellular functions to build or repair cells," Dr. Shamban explains. "Acting as a ‘light switch,’ they can turn on or off any specific functions. For our skin, they are short amino acid chains in the proteins responsible for the production of our collagen, elastin, and keratin — all highly important foundational support functions for healthy skin proliferation."

In short, peptides can do all sorts of wonderful things for your skin, especially, Dr. Shamban explains, when paired with antioxidants and retinoids. You can use a peptide serum both in the morning and nighttime, but be aware that AHAs (alpha-hydroxy acids) may reduce its efficacy. Also, using stronger forms of retinoids along with peptide serums might be too aggressive for some people, so you may want to talk to your dermatologist about lowering to a less potent retinoid. You can also reduce retinoid application to twice weekly while you're integrating a peptide serum into your routine. "After a few weeks you can return to every other night, alternating the peptides and the retinoid product," Dr. Shamban says. As always, daily sunscreen application is a must.

The Overall Best Peptide Serum

The Paula's Choice Peptide Booster contains eight different peptides, including hexapeptides, which promote smoother, more even-looking skin, and palmitoyl tetrapeptide-7, which works to fight inflammation, protect against UV damage, and "promote the production of collagen and the cellular humectant hyaluronic acid," says Dr. Shamban. In short, this serum aims to make your skin look (and feel) firmer, clearer, and more hydrated. With its lightweight, silky feel and fragrance-free formula, it's a great choice for any skin type. Use it on its own, or add a few drops into your favorite moisturizer to give it a boost (hence its name).

Runner Up

The ingredients in this Jack Black Protein Booster Skin Serum include palmitoyl oligopeptide, which provides the same skin-smoothing benefits as retinol without the side effects, Dr. Shamban says. "Both retinol and palmitoyl can preserve and renew collagen in skin damaged by ultraviolet light, so it's a good protectant against sun damage.” This is another lightweight, silky serum that should work for most skin types, and it can be used on its own or mixed in with moisturizer. Antioxidants like green tea and hydrating ingredients, like jojoba oil and aloe leaf juice, round out the multi-tasking formula.

The Best Copper Peptide Serum

Korres' Golden Krocus Elixir is certainly the most splurge-worthy serum on this list. What sets this "golden elixir" apart from the rest is its impressive formula, which contains copper peptides, beta-glucans, amino acids, and a whole host of rare botanical extracts, most notably krocus flowers — which bloom only once a year in Greece — to restore skin to its most radiant. Copper peptides work to promote collagen and elastin production, resulting in smoother, plumper skin, and may even have wound-repairing, damage-reversing benefits.
